This signature detects attempts to exploit a known vulnerability in BlueZone. A successful attack can lead to a buffer overflow and arbitrary remote code execution within the context of the targeted application.
BlueZone Desktop is prone to a remote denial-of-service vulnerability. An attacker can exploit this issue to cause an affected application to crash, denying service to legitimate users. Note that the issue may be exploited to execute arbitrary code; however, this has not been confirmed.
